Metal Complexes of Functionalized Sulfur-Containing Ligands, III[1]. - Reactions of (Ph3P)2Pt(η2-C2H4) with Acyclic and Cyclic Thiosulfinates: Platinum(II)-thiolato Complexes with Sulfenato Ligands. Crystal Structure Determination of (4-Sulfido-1-butanesulfenato-S,S′)bis(triphenylphosphane)platinum(II) Oxidative addition of acyclic thiosulfinates R′-S(O)-S-R (1a: R′ = R = CH3; 1b: R′ = R = Ph; 1c: R′ = R = p-CH3C6H4;1d: R′ = p-ClC6H4, R = C6H5) to (Ph3P)2Pt(η2-C2H4) (4) leads to the monomeric trans-configurated complexes (Ph3P)2Pt[S(O)R′](SR) (5a-d) which loose one PPh3 ligand in solution and form the dimetallic thiolato-bridged compounds [(Ph3P)Pt[S(O)R′](μ-SR)]2. The cyclic thiosulfinates 1,2-dithiane S-oxide (2) and 1,4-dihydro-2,3-benzodithiine S-oxide (3) react with 4 to yield the monomeric seven-membered chelate (7) and the dimetallic complex [(Ph3P)Pt-S(O)-CH2-C6H4-CH2-μ-S]2 (8), respectively. In 7, characterized by X-ray diffraction, a tetrahedral distortion of the square planar coordination of the platinum(II) atoms is remarkable; the planes Pt,P(1),P(2) and Pt,S(1),S(2) form an angle of 16.1°.
